Eastern Europe Is Often Considered for Technical Expertise

Eastern European countries are known for strong engineering and development talent. Many organizations explore this region for software development and technical roles that require deep specialization.

However, significant time zone differences create collaboration delays for U.S. teams. Communication can feel formal and less conversational, which affects user-facing IT outsourcing solutions such as helpdesk and troubleshooting functions where clarity and speed matter.

Latin America Offers Proximity Advantages for U.S. Firms

Latin America is attractive because of its geographic closeness to the United States. Real-time collaboration is easier, and cultural similarities support smoother communication.

Spanish bilingual support is valuable for certain customer bases. Still, rising labor costs and limited workforce depth in some countries make scaling IT outsourcing solutions more challenging for midmarket firms seeking larger teams.

India Has Long Been Associated With Large Scale Outsourcing

India built its reputation on scale and technical education. Large IT teams can be deployed quickly, and the country has decades of experience in global outsourcing.

Yet, companies often report communication challenges when roles require constant interaction with end users. Managing large structures for IT outsourcing solutions can also require additional oversight, adding complexity for lean internal IT departments.

English Proficiency and Communication Clarity Directly Affect IT Support Quality

IT issues are often resolved through conversation. Users describe problems in non-technical terms. Support teams interpret, ask questions, and guide solutions step by step.

In the Philippines, English fluency and neutral accents reduce misunderstandings. This clarity shortens resolution time and improves the overall experience delivered through IT outsourcing solutions.

Miscommunication in IT support leads to repeated tickets and user frustration. Clear dialogue prevents small issues from escalating into recurring problems.

The Philippines Produces a Workforce Trained for IT Service Roles

The Philippines produces thousands of IT and engineering graduates every year. Many of these graduates enter the BPO industry where they receive additional training in service delivery, documentation, and process discipline.

This blend of technical knowledge and structured workflow preparation makes the country ideal for IT outsourcing solutions that require consistency. Teams are accustomed to ticketing systems, service-level agreements, and reporting standards expected by U.S. companies.
